India Scraps Small-Car Fuel Rule Break in 2027 Norms After Industry Objections
- •India drops planned concession for small cars in 2027 fuel-efficiency rules after objections from automakers like Tata Motors and Mahindra & Mahindra.
- •A September draft had proposed leniency for petrol cars weighing 909 kg or less, widely seen as favoring Maruti Suzuki.
- •The Power Ministry removed the exemption and tightened parameters, increasing pressure on all automakers to boost EV and hybrid sales.
- •New rules curb over-compensation for vehicle weight and aim for real-world efficiency gains, introducing a steeper reduction pathway for emissions.
- •The revised plan aims to cut average fleet emissions to about 100 grams/km by March 2032, with credits for EVs potentially lowering it to 76 grams/km.
